Transaction 052698b14e6b3cbf06520d3e92304d767ce280c5ba3e085649bf8c64a0c7211b
1 Input
1 Output
-
052698b14e6b3cbf06520d3e92304d767ce280c5ba3e085649bf8c64a0c7211b:0
- value
- 17861009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 861d04c6a5e0c7c89fea3005011c1513b6ba545d OP_EQUAL
- address
- ML8HYPQFf4PSmdbKnUZe6ndEyusCSHJUrF